I have worked with Microsoft Office 365 support, and they have not come up with a solutions to this problem. Outlook 365 was able to encrypt emails in the past, but can no longer do so. This issue has affected both computers in the office. If I use the web version, it works fine. So it is not a licensing problem.

Anyone have any ideas on how to get this back working?

    Do you use Exchange online? If so, use command below to check whether the certificate published to GAL:

    Get-Mailbox <user> | FL or FT *user*  
    

    If certificate isn't published, you need to publish it with step below(You need to install user certificate to local computer first):
